What problem does it solve?

Finds and evaluates grant opportunities, determines fit, and creates a clear opportunity brief to decide whether to pursue a call.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Opportunity discovery from live funding calls
  • Eligibility and fit screening
  • Funder-fit profiling
  • Proposal kickoff prep and artifacts (opportunity brief, go/watch/discard, GitHub issue)
  • Persist results to GitHub when available or to the conversation/local workspace otherwise
